The Brindlekiosk watchdog restarts the shell app whenever the heartbeat endpoint goes silent for 90 seconds. It runs as a separate process under the kiosk user and logs restarts to the Pell telemetry service. New maintainers should verify the watchdog can authenticate to Pell before deploying. The key it uses for telemetry uploads is below.

service key, bajog-yahop: kto7_mMHVCpJ

Handover Note — From Director P. Halloway to Director R. Enstrade

Heads of department: the gross-margin review for Tarnwell Fabrication is mid-stream. Materials costing is done; logistics and warranty allocations remain. Early figures show margin slippage in the Corvale product line, driven mostly by freight. Rueben takes ownership of the remaining workstreams from next week. Department inputs are due by month-end. The commercial implications we intend to act on are set out below.

confidential, kagup-bafog: Fraaxax Group is in early talks to buy Soroxox Group for about $343.8 million. The Olidor launch date is June 14, and nothing goes to the press before then. Legal wants the Aldmirek Logistics term sheet signed before July 23.

## Further reading

The Larkspur public API uses cursor-based pagination throughout; offset parameters are deprecated and will be removed in v4. Cursors are opaque and expire after 24 hours, so clients should not persist them. For design rationale, edge cases, and examples of resuming interrupted pagination, see the internal design doc linked here.

operations page: https://jenkins.zemvarcloud.local/job/merge_requests/repo/build/73930b4b30f0a8ed